Memorials, Recognition - Allan Dale Hannah -
HJR 911 is a ceremonial resolution honoring Allan Dale Hannah for his 50 years of service with the Pikeville Volunteer Fire Department. It recognizes his roles as Lieutenant, Captain, and Assistant Chief, as well as his contributions to expanding the department's equipment and services. The resolution was unanimously passed by the Tennessee General Assembly and signed into law in February 2026. This bill directly affects only Mr. Hannah, with no policy changes or broader legislative impact.
